Let's begin the analysis.

BlackRock's resumption of Bitcoin purchases holds significant implications for the cryptocurrency market. Currently, BlackRock holds over $54 billion worth of Bitcoin, demonstrating the fastest growth rate among Bitcoin ETFs.

Firstly, BlackRock's renewal of Bitcoin purchases can be interpreted as a signal that institutional investors trust Bitcoin. Institutional investors generally aim for cautious and long-term investments, so their moves can be seen as reflecting a positive evaluation of Bitcoin’s market fundamentals.

Secondly, it is notable that such institutional investment is increasing mainstream acceptance of the Bitcoin market. As Bitcoin is incorporated into a wider range of investment portfolios, this implies that Bitcoin's role within the traditional financial system could become more substantial.

Lastly, BlackRock's investment in Bitcoin emphasizes the importance of Bitcoin as an alternative to the centralized financial system. Bitcoin can be a better solution to address the issues of opacity and manipulability present in the traditional financial system, and BlackRock's move reaffirms the potential of Bitcoin from this perspective.

This analysis could help reinforce Bitcoin’s role as a long-term store of value. It will be highly noteworthy to see how BlackRock's moves will impact the future cryptocurrency investment market.
